Senior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) Analyst

Momentum for HealthSan Jose, CA
$95,000 - $130,000

About The Position

We are seeking a highly analytical and mission-driven FP&A Analyst to support the financial planning, reporting, budgeting, forecasting, and revenue cycle analytics functions of our growing behavioral health organization. The ideal candidate will bring strong financial acumen, healthcare reimbursement knowledge, and experience working with public behavioral health funding models, particularly within Santa Clara County Behavioral Health Services, Medi-Cal programs, or comparable California county behavioral health systems. This role will partner closely with Finance, Accounting, Revenue Cycle, Clinical Operations, and Program Leadership to provide actionable financial insights, improve reimbursement performance, monitor contract utilization, and support strategic decision-making. A successful candidate will have a strong understanding of behavioral health billing, denial management, reimbursement rates, cost reporting, and Maximum Financial Obligation (MFO) processes.

Responsibilities

  • Develop, maintain, and enhance financial models for budgeting, forecasting, and long-range planning.
  •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ial analyses, including variance reporting and operational performance metrics.
  • Analyze revenue, expenses, productivity, and program profitability to identify trends, risks, and opportunities.
  • Support annual budgeting and periodic forecast processes across multiple programs and funding sources.
  • Produce financial dashboards and key performance indicators (KPIs) for executive leadership.
  • Monitor and analyze behavioral health revenue streams, including Medi-Cal, County contracts, grants, commercial insurance, and other funding sources.
  • Track billing performance, reimbursement trends, denial rates, claim aging, and collections.
  • Collaborate with Accounting, Revenue Cycle and Operations teams to identify and resolve billing and reimbursement issues that affect the budget.
  • Evaluate the financial impact of rate changes, funding adjustments, and regulatory requirements.
  • Analyze contract performance against budget and utilization targets.
  • Support financial reporting and analysis related to Santa Clara County contracts, Medi-Cal programs, and other government-funded behavioral health services.
  • Monitor and validate reimbursement methodologies, funding allocations, and service utilization.
  • Assist with financial reporting requirements associated with county contracts and behavioral health programs, including Executive Management & Board reports
  • Provide analysis supporting audits, cost reports, and regulatory reviews.
